The "willowy woman" in the tavern at the end of A Gentleman in Moscow is not identified, but the adjective "willowy" alone is enough to suggest very strongly that this is Anna, Count Rostov's former inamorata and the only woman in the text who is identified with this epithet. The word "willowy" most obviously refers to Anna's figure, but there is also an expression in Central and Eastern Europe (of which someone from Count Rostov's background would almost certainly have been aware): a hollow willow is one in whom secrets may be confided. Published in 2016, A Gentleman in Moscow, by American author Amor Towles, is the story of Count Alexander Rostov, a Russian nobleman who, after the Bolshevik Revolution of 1917, is sentenced to lifelong imprisonment in Moscow's Metropol Hotel. A historical novel set in Moscow from 1918 through the 1950s, it follows Count Alexander Ilyich Rostov, a cultured and well-educated Russian nobleman who rushes back to his country in the early days of the Revolution, only to narrowly escape the firing squad and get sentenced to life imprisonment within his hotel, the Metropol. 2023 eNotes.com, Inc.
